Select Brand:

Show All


£37.76

Dispatch on next business day

£36.81

Dispatch on next business day

£59.25

Dispatch on next business day

£26.32

Dispatch on next business day

£46.34

Dispatch on next business day

£96.79

Dispatch on next business day

£31.04

Dispatch on next business day

£31.61

Dispatch on next business day

£40.25

Dispatch on next business day

£37.25

Dispatch on next business day

£43.93

Dispatch on next business day

£56.92

Dispatch on next business day